Count me in Doob. SLO is a little far to the south, but upon checking the map there is nothing any farther north until Monterey. I’d love to have this at Big Sur, but we would have to be reserving campsites now and there are few inexpensive accomodations in that area.

We definitely want to check on possible conventions, graduations or other events in SLO before committing on a date. When you consider the normal rowdy factor in that town, we would all have to be on our very worst behavior to even make a dent in things.

I’m up for San Simeon (Hearst Castle) as I have never been there and am a huge fan of Julia Morgan. However, allow me to be the first to suggest a Sunday morning road trip to Solvang for brunch. Some of the restaurants there have a very decent smørgasbord (high praise from this Danish food snob).

Get this ladies! A town where every other shop sells fine chocolate. What’s that you say? Ah, Solvang it is! It is only one hour (60 miles) south from SLO and would have the LA dopers on their way back home, so there has to be some appeal right there. There are also some wineries in the area for a post brunch activity.

There are some nice small coastal towns up the coast a bit. Cambria is nice, pretty tourist trap, pines and all. A family friend lives there (Catholic priest). Nice restaurant called Lynn’s (Basically homestyle food). PLus they sell pies and preserves (Sour cherry and Kiwi, among others). I’ve heard Solvang is nice also.
